Why Join The Team?

The Senior Staff - Control Systems (Manager grade level) will be responsible to design, validate and certify the engine control systems for gas turbine engines, including new centrelines, derivative legacy engines, and hybrid/new technology demonstrators. The successful incumbent will develop system level requirements for engine controls. During the engine/aircraft concept phase, he/she will work with aircraft manufacturers to develop control system functionality.

He/she will work with an integrated product team (Performance, Operability, System Safety, Design disciplines, Customer Support, etc.) to match control system functionality against the engine and aircraft requirements. The successful incumbent will understand power plant dynamics and DO-178C process as they prepare the evidence to support the engine type certificate.

He/She will also work closely with suppliers to verify software, and review data for control system tests performed on simulations, engine and aircraft, and investigate field events.

This is a full-time position from Monday to Friday with flexible hours, based in Mississauga, and performed exclusively on-site.

What will your day-to-day look like?
  • Create control system requirements by working closely with internal and external customers.
  • Work closely with P&WC software design department and other software suppliers to ensure that system requirements are interpreted and implemented as intended.
  • Create control system test plans/procedures used to validate control systems on simulated closed-loop benches, in a P&WC engine test cell, and on experimental flight test aircraft.
  • Support P&WC engine test department and suppliers' closed-loop bench test facilities to ensure smooth execution of validation activity.
  • Support customer flight test activity.
  • Review and interpret test data produced during validation testing.
  • Generate top-level certification reports for submittal to national and foreign airworthiness certification authorities.
  • Engage in continuous improvement to organizational processes based on lessons learned.
  • Provide technical support to P&WC's manufacturing sector to ensure smooth transition of new products into production.
  • Provide technical support to P&WC's aftermarket sector to resolve field issues.
